Understanding the Importance of Drive Shaft Support

The drive shaft support is an integral component in your vehicle’s drivetrain system. It's designed to maintain the alignment of the drive shaft, allowing it to spin freely while transferring torque from the engine to the wheels. Without this crucial part, the efficiency and performance of the car's transmission system can be severely compromised.

How the Component Works

This assembly includes a bearing encased in rubber, which acts as a cushion to absorb vibrations and shocks from the road. It holds the drive shaft securely in place, allowing it to rotate smoothly at high speeds without causing damage to surrounding parts. The balanced rotation of the drive shaft ensures that the power generated by the engine is effectively transmitted to the wheels, providing a smooth and efficient drive.

Consequences of a Faulty Support Assembly

When this part wears out or fails, you might experience symptoms like vibrations or clunks coming from underneath the car, especially during acceleration. Ignoring these signs can lead to severe damage to the drive shaft or other drivetrain components, potentially resulting in costly repairs. A broken or worn-out support can also decrease vehicle stability and increase wear on other parts, leading to reduced overall performance and safety.
